How to make big profits in day trading penny stocks?
Obviously, you need to find the best penny stocks to invest in. One of the criteria you should look at is the market capitalization of the companies that are listed. A company’s market capitalization (usually referred to as market cap) is found by multiplying its share price by the number of shares available. That number should be relatively small when compared to other companies in the sector for the stock to represent a great growth opportunity. Of course, different people will have different criteria, but it makes sense that the cheaper the stock, the more growth potential it has, provided that it’s a good company in a profitable sector.
If you come across a penny stock company that’s touted as “the next Microsoft”, or “The next Google”, chances are it’s a “pump-and-dump” scam. Because of their low price, penny stocks are prime targets for people trying to influence their prices by hyping them up without anything really substantial to back their claims. That leads us to the final point of being a successful penny stock day trader. Successful penny stock day traders don’t hold on to their winning stocks with the hopes of retiring from the profits of that one trade. This is the province of long term investors. If anything, most day traders will sell a portion of their holdings in that stock to recoup their initial investment, and will then ride the remaining shares as long as possible.
Every investor getting into day trading penny stocks tells themselves that they won’t fall for the hype that surrounds many penny stock offerings, but unfortunately the vast majority of them do, out of fear that they might miss out on the next big thing. Remember that one wise man once said that “you don’t have any profits until you sell”, so no matter how high that stock you’re holding has gone, until you sell it, you haven’t made money yet.
